#N/A와 #VALUE! 오류에 지치셨나요? AI로 깨진 Excel 수식 고치기

핵심 요약:

  • 복잡한 Excel 수식을 수동으로 디버깅하는 것은 시간 소모가 크고 답답한 작업입니다. 보통 전후 관계를 셀 하나씩 추적하고 중첩된 함수를 분해해 단 한 가지 실수를 찾느라 많은 시간이 걸립니다.
  • Excelmatic과 같은 Excel AI 도구는 수동 문제 해결을 우회합니다. 깨진 수식을 고치려 애쓰는 대신, 원하는 결과를 평이한 문장으로 설명하면 AI가 처음부터 정확히 작동하는 수식을 생성해줍니다.
  • Excel AI 에이전트를 사용하면 오류를 몇 초 만에 고칠 수 있을 뿐만 아니라 올바른 수식 구조를 배워 정확도가 향상되고, 이전에 디버깅에 소비하던 수시간을 절약할 수 있습니다.

문제 배경 및 고충

당신은 동료로부터 중요한 매출 보고서를 넘겨받았습니다. 여러 시트와 복잡한 calculations, 수년치 데이터가 뒤엉킨 방대한 통합 문서입니다. 매니저는 간단한 요약을 요청했지만 데이터를 새로 고치자 화면에 오류들이 별자리처럼 떠오릅니다: #N/A, #VALUE!, #REF!. 순식간에 "간단한 작업"은 포렌식 조사로 바뀝니다.

이 상황은 수백만 명의 Excel 사용자에게 너무나 익숙합니다. 쉼표 하나의 오타, 잘못된 셀 범위, 또는 긴 중첩 수식 안의 미묘한 데이터 형식 불일치가 전체 분석을 멈추게 할 수 있습니다. 데이터에 대한 신뢰는 사라지고 당신의 생산성은 급격히 떨어집니다.

진짜 고통은 단순한 오류 자체가 아니라 이를 고치는 지루한 과정입니다. 당신은 스스로 이렇게 묻게 됩니다:

  • 왜 보이는 값이 있는데도 이 VLOOKUP은 값을 찾지 못할까?
  • 이 10줄짜리 중첩된 IF 문 중 어느 부분이 #VALUE! 오류를 일으키는 걸까?
  • 어제는 정상적으로 작동했는데 새 행을 추가하자 왜 여기저기서 #REF!가 나타나지?

이런 실수를 찾는 일은 건초더미에서 바늘을 찾는 기분입니다. 부가가치가 없는 작업이 정신적 에너지를 소모하고 중요한 비즈니스 결정을 지연시킵니다.

전통적인 Excel 해결법: 수동 디버깅 도구 모음

수식이 깨졌을 때 경험 많은 Excel 사용자는 보통 표준 수동 디버깅 도구를 사용합니다. 과정은 논리적이지만 종종 느리고 고된 작업입니다.

일반적인 접근법은 탐정이 되어 Excel의 내장 기능을 사용해 문제의 근원을 추적하는 것입니다.

  1. 오류 검사 및 툴팁: 첫 번째 단계는 종종 셀 옆의 작은 오류 아이콘을 클릭하는 것입니다. Excel은 "수식에서 사용된 값의 데이터 형식이 잘못되었습니다."와 같은 모호한 제안을 합니다. 때로는 도움이 되지만 복잡한 수식에서는 정확한 원인을 잘 지적하지 못합니다.

  2. 선행/후행 셀 추적: "수식" 탭에서 Trace Precedents를 사용해 현재 수식에 영향을 주는 모든 셀로 화살표를 그릴 수 있습니다. 데이터가 밀집한 스프레드시트에서는 금세 혼란스러운 "거미줄"이 되어버립니다.

    1

  3. 수식 평가: 이 기능(역시 "수식" 탭 아래)은 대화상자를 열어 수식의 계산 과정을 부분별로 단계화해 볼 수 있게 해줍니다. =A2+B2처럼 간단한 수식에는 유용하지만 =IF(VLOOKUP(A2, 'Data'!$A:$F, 3, FALSE)>500, "High Value", "Low Value")처럼 복잡한 수식에서는 문제를 분리하기 위해 "평가"를 수십 번 클릭해야 하므로 인내심을 시험합니다.

  4. 수동 검사 (F9 트릭): 고급 기법으로 수식 입력줄에서 수식의 일부를 선택한 뒤 F9 키를 눌러 선택한 부분만 계산 결과를 확인할 수 있습니다. 강력하지만 위험합니다. Escape를 누르는 대신 실수로 Enter를 누르면 해당 부분이 계산된 값으로 영구 대체됩니다.

수동 접근법의 한계

이 방법들이 결국 해결책으로 이어지지만 비효율성이 많습니다:

  • 극도로 시간 소모적: 단순한 논리 오류 하나를 진단하고 고치는 데도 통합 문서에 익숙하지 않은 사람에게는 30분에서 1시간 이상 걸릴 수 있습니다.
  • 깊은 전문성 필요: 효과적으로 디버깅하려면 함수가 단지 무엇을 하는지뿐 아니라 실패하는지를 이해해야 합니다. VLOOKUP의 흔한 함정을 알고, SUMIFS의 데이터 형식 요건을 이해하며, INDEX/MATCH의 문법을 알아야 합니다.
  • 높은 인지 부담: 중첩 함수, 셀 참조, 평가 단계를 정신적으로 유지하는 것은 피로를 불러오고 실수를 유발합니다. 하나의 문제를 "고치다" 또 다른 문제를 만들 수도 있습니다.
  • 확장성 부족: 오류가 수백 행에 걸쳐 있다면 하나씩 고치는 것은 현실적인 방법이 아닙니다. 템플릿 수식에서 근본 원인을 찾아야 하는데, 그게 가장 어렵습니다.

새로운 해결책: Excel AI 에이전트 사용(Excelmatic)

오류를 수동으로 찾는 대신, 원하는 결과를 설명하면 전문가가 즉시 수식을 만들어주는 기능이 있다면 어떨까요? 이것이 Excelmatic과 같은 Excel AI 에이전트가 제공하는 패러다임 전환입니다.

excelmatic

AI 에이전트는 개인 엑셀 컨설턴트 역할을 합니다. 파일을 업로드하고 평이한 언어로 목표를 설명하면 AI가 수식 작성, 디버깅, 설명까지 복잡한 작업을 처리합니다.

단계별: Excelmatic으로 수식 고치기

깨진 매출 보고서 사례를 다시 보겠습니다. Excelmatic으로 몇 분 안에 해결하는 방법은 다음과 같습니다.

1. Excel 파일 업로드

먼저 Excel 또는 CSV 파일을 Excelmatic에 안전하게 업로드합니다. 플랫폼은 원본 파일을 수정하지 않고 구조와 내용을 읽기만 합니다. 열에 명확한 헤더(예: "Sale Date", "Region", "Sales Rep", "Sale Amount")가 있는지 확인하세요.

업로드

2. 목표를 평이한 언어로 설명

가장 중요한 단계입니다. 깨진 수식을 고치려 들지 마세요. 수식이 아닌, 해당 셀이 무엇을 담아야 하는지 간단히 말합니다.

사용할 수 있는 프롬프트 예시:

  • "G열에는 총액을 계산하는 수식이 필요합니다. E열의 'Unit Price'에 F열의 'Quantity'를 곱하면 됩니다."
  • "H열의 VLOOKUP이 깨졌습니다. B열의 'Sales Rep ID'로 각 'Region'을 찾아오고 싶습니다. 조회 테이블은 'Reps' 시트의 A와 C열에 있습니다."
  • "D열의 'Sale Amount'가 $10,000보다 크면 'Bonus Eligible', 아니면 'Not Eligible'을 반환하는 수식이 필요합니다. 현재 #NAME? 오류가 납니다."
  • "이 수식이 무엇을 하는지 설명하고 더 간단한 대안을 제안해줄 수 있나요? =IF(ISERROR(VLOOKUP(A2,Sheet2!A:B,2,0)),"Not Found",VLOOKUP(A2,Sheet2!A:B,2,0))"

질문하기

3. 올바른 수식과 설명 받기

Excelmatic은 요청과 데이터를 분석합니다. 그러면 다음을 제공합니다:

  1. 정확한 수식: 깨끗하고 작동하는 수식(종종 VLOOKUP 대신 더 효율적인 최신 함수인 XLOOKUP을 사용).
  2. 설명: 수식이 어떻게 동작하는지 평이한 언어로 간단하게 분해해 알려주어 논리를 배우는 데 도움이 됩니다.
  3. 미리보기: 새 수식이 적용된 데이터 미리보기를 제공해 즉시 정상 작동을 확인할 수 있습니다.

4. 결과 다운로드

만족하면 새 수식을 복사해 원본 통합 문서에 붙여넣거나, 수정된 열이 반영된 새 Excel 파일을 다운로드할 수 있습니다.

대화 예시: 오류에서 통찰로

일반적인 상호작용 예시는 다음과 같습니다:

사용자: 판매 테이블이 있습니다. F열의 내 수식 =VLOOKUP(A2, 'Rates'!A:B, 2, FALSE) * E2가 많은 행에서 #N/A를 반환합니다. 판매액에 담당자 수수료율을 곱해 커미션을 계산하려고 합니다.

Excelmatic: 문제를 확인했습니다. VLOOKUP#N/A를 반환하면 곱셈이 작동하지 않습니다. 이는 보통 A열의 ID에 여분의 공백이 있거나 'Rates' 시트에 해당 ID가 없을 때 발생합니다.

이 경우를 우아하게 처리할 수 있도록 XLOOKUPIFERROR를 사용한 더 견고한 수식을 제안할 수 있습니다:

=IFERROR(XLOOKUP(TRIM(A2), 'Rates'!A:A, 'Rates'!B:B, 0) * E2, 0)

이 수식의 동작 방식:

  1. TRIM(A2)는 ID의 앞뒤 공백을 제거합니다.
  2. XLOOKUP은 정리된 ID를 찾아 해당 수수료율을 반환합니다. 찾지 못하면 기본값으로 0을 반환합니다.
  3. IFERROR(..., 0)는 최종 안전장치 역할을 합니다. 다른 오류가 발생하면 오류 메시지 대신 0을 반환합니다.

이걸 시트에 적용해드릴까요?

전통적 디버깅 vs. Excelmatic

항목 전통적 수동 디버깅 Excelmatic AI 에이전트
수정 시간 15-60분 이상 < 1분
필요한 기술 함수와 오류 유형에 대한 깊은 지식 달성하려는 목표를 설명하는 언어 능력
과정 수동, 반복적 추적과 추측 직접적이고 대화형 지시
결과 단일 수식의 수정 정확하고 설명된, 종종 개선된 수식
학습 시행착오를 통한 학습 명확한 설명을 통한 가이드형 학습

FAQ

Q1: Excelmatic을 사용하려면 Excel 전문가여야 하나요?
아니요. 정반대입니다. Excelmatic은 무엇을 달성하고 싶은지 알고 있지만 복잡한 수식 문법에 얽매이고 싶지 않은 사용자를 위해 설계되었습니다. 목표를 설명할 수 있다면 사용할 수 있습니다.

Q2: Excelmatic이 내 원본 Excel 파일을 수정하나요?
아니요. 원본 파일은 읽기 전용으로 사용됩니다. 모든 분석과 결과는 Excelmatic 플랫폼 내에서 생성됩니다. 이후 변경 사항이 반영된 새 파일을 다운로드하는 것을 선택할 수 있습니다.

Q3: 회사 데이터를 Excelmatic에 업로드해도 안전한가요?
데이터 프라이버시와 보안은 최우선 사항입니다. Excelmatic은 엄격한 보안 프로토콜하에 데이터를 처리합니다. 데이터 처리 및 암호화에 대한 구체적인 내용은 항상 공식 개인정보처리방침을 참조하세요. 플랫폼은 비즈니스 사용을 염두에 두고 설계되었습니다.

Q4: Excelmatic이 아무리 복잡한 수식이라도 모두 고칠 수 있나요?
Excelmatic은 조회, 논리문, 텍스트 처리, 집계 등 표준 Excel 함수의 대부분을 매우 잘 처리합니다. 매우 특수한 커스텀 VBA 스크립트나 서드파티 애드인 함수의 경우 수동 검토가 필요할 수 있습니다. 그러나 매우 복잡한 표준 수식의 논리를 설명하는 데에도 자주 도움이 됩니다.

*Q5: AI가 내 원본 수식이 왜 잘못되었는지 이유를 설명해주나요?*
네. 이것이 주요 장점 중 하나입니다. 목표를 설명하고 깨진 수식을 보여주면 AI에게 "내 버전이 왜 작동하지 않나요?"라고 물을 수 있습니다. AI는 종종 문제를 진단해줍니다(예: "VLOOKUP 범위가 잘못되었습니다" 또는 "숫자에 텍스트를 곱하려고 했습니다" 등).

오늘부터 오류를 통찰로 바꾸세요

#REF! 오류를 찾느라 소비하는 모든 분은 데이터를 분석하고 비즈니스 가치를 창출하는 데 쓰지 못하는 시간입니다. 수식을 디버깅하는 전통적인 방식은 사용자가 전문가여야 했던 과거의 유물입니다.

Excelmatic 같은 Excel AI 에이전트를 사용하면 "이걸 어떻게 고치지?"에서 "다음에 어떤 질문을 할까?"로 초점을 옮길 수 있습니다. 문법, 디버깅, 지루한 작업은 AI에 맡기고 당신은 비즈니스 논리를 제공하세요. Excelmatic이 결과를 제공합니다.

수식으로 인한 답답함을 멈추세요. 원래 문제를 일으키던 그 스프레드시트를 업로드하고 얼마나 빠르게 정확한 작동 수식을 얻을 수 있는지 확인하려면 Try Excelmatic for free today를 이용해 보세요.

AI로 데이터를 강화하고, 의사결정을 확실하게!

코드나 함수 작성 없이, 간단한 대화로 Excelmatic이 데이터를 자동으로 처리하고 차트를 생성합니다. 지금 무료로 체험하고 AI가 Excel 워크플로우를 어떻게 혁신하는지 경험해보세요 →

지금 무료로 체험하기

추천 게시글

복잡한 수식은 이제 그만: AI 시대에 엑셀의 LET 함수는 여전히 유용할까?
엑셀 팁

복잡한 수식은 이제 그만: AI 시대에 엑셀의 LET 함수는 여전히 유용할까?

복잡한 엑셀 수식에 지치셨나요? LET 함수도 한계가 있습니다. Excelmatic의 AI를 사용하면 수식 없이, 자연어로 질문해 바로 결과를 얻을 수 있습니다.

Ruby
Excel에서 동적 숫자 목록을 생성하는 간편한 방법
엑셀 팁

Excel에서 동적 숫자 목록을 생성하는 간편한 방법

수식을 끌어서 만드는 데 지치셨나요? 이 가이드에서는 동적 목록, 캘린더 등을 생성하는 Excel의 강력한 SEQUENCE 함수를 자세히 살펴봅니다. 또한 기존 방법과 질문만으로 동일한 작업을 수행할 수 있는 새로운 AI 접근법을 비교해 드립니다.

Ruby
Excel 무작위 순서 수동 할당은 그만: 더 빠른 AI 방법
엑셀 팁

Excel 무작위 순서 수동 할당은 그만: 더 빠른 AI 방법

엑셀에서 수동으로 무작위 배정을 하느라 지치셨나요? 고유한 랜덤 목록 생성을 위한 복잡하고 변덕스러운 수식은 이제 잊으세요. Excelmatic의 AI가 간단한 채팅 명령으로 이벤트 기획이나 팀 배정을 위한 무작위 정렬 및 그룹화를 몇 초 만에 처리하는 방법을 확인해 보세요.

Ruby
빈 행 수동 삭제는 이제 그만: 엑셀 AI로 몇 초 만에 해결하는 법
엑셀 팁

빈 행 수동 삭제는 이제 그만: 엑셀 AI로 몇 초 만에 해결하는 법

스프레드시트의 빈 행은 수식을 깨뜨리고 보고서를 망칠 수 있습니다. '이동 옵션'이나 '필터' 같은 수동 방식은 느리고 실수의 위험이 있습니다. Excelmatic과 같은 엑셀 AI 에이전트가 간단한 명령만으로 모든 빈 행을 제거하고 단 몇 초 만에 데이터를 정리하는 방법을 확인해 보세요.

Ruby
Excel 사용자 지정 정렬에 시간 낭비 마세요: AI를 활용한 더 빠른 방법
엑셀 자동화

Excel 사용자 지정 정렬에 시간 낭비 마세요: AI를 활용한 더 빠른 방법

사용자 지정, 비알파벳 순서로 Excel 데이터를 정렬하는 데 어려움을 겪고 계신가요? 수동으로 사용자 지정 목록(Custom Lists)을 만드는 것은 답답하고 비효율적인 작업입니다. Excelmatic과 같은 Excel AI 에이전트를 사용하면 간단한 영어 문장 하나로 복잡한 다단계 정렬을 처리하여, 지루한 작업을 단 몇 번의 클릭으로 끝낼 수 있습니다.

Ruby
Excel에서 체크 표시 사용 완벽 가이드 (모든 방법)
엑셀 팁

Excel에서 체크 표시 사용 완벽 가이드 (모든 방법)

Excel에서 체크 표시 추가 방법 완벽 가이드. 기본 기호부터 대화형 체크박스, 고급 조건부 서식 및 진행률 추적기까지 모든 것을 다룹니다. 기존 기술과 워크플로우를 간소화하는 새로운 AI 기반 빠른 방법을 발견하세요.

Ruby
스프레드시트 오류 방지: Excel에서 셀 잠그는 방법 (그리고 AI에 맡겨야 할 때)
엑셀 팁

스프레드시트 오류 방지: Excel에서 셀 잠그는 방법 (그리고 AI에 맡겨야 할 때)

스프레드시트 오류를 방지하는 Excel 고정 셀 참조의 힘을 발견하세요. 이 가이드는 절대, 상대, 혼합 참조를 다루며 시간과 노력을 절약해주는 혁신적인 AI 접근법을 소개합니다.

Ruby
복잡한 수식 학습 그만: Excel AI가 경력 성장을 여는 방법
엑셀 팁

복잡한 수식 학습 그만: Excel AI가 경력 성장을 여는 방법

Excel에서 매주 매출 보고서를 만드는 고된 반복 작업에 지치셨나요? 혼자가 아닙니다. 지루한 SUMIFS와 수작업 pivot table 설정을 버리고 Excel AI로 몇 분 만에 인사이트를 얻어 눈에 띄는 전략적 업무에 집중하는 방법을 알려드립니다.

Ruby